The ROTOSOUNDRS66LD Swing Bass Electric Bass 4 String Set (45-105) is a premium set of stainless steel strings designed for electric bass guitars. Manufactured in the United Kingdom, these strings offer exceptional durability and sound quality, making them a top choice for professional musicians and enthusiasts alike.

Loud rock bass strings
I put these on an 80s Kramer Striker bass. Rotosound has the bite and grit required for loud rock and metal bass playing. The feel is rougher than nickel roundwounds but you get used to it quickly.For the first week, the treble response was incredible and every note would sing like a piano string. This tapered off after a week and now they sound like standard nickel roundwounds but with a mid-range bump.Buy a set if you've ever wanted your bass to sound super bright and cut through a mix like nobody's business.
